Russian actor Maxim Glotov was found dead in his apartment in Moscow. This is reported by the Shot telegram channel.
"The artist has not been in touch with relatives and friends for several days, who have sounded the alarm. This afternoon he was found in his own apartment on Vuchetich Street in the capital," the publication says.
Glotov was 60 years old.
Maxim Glotov was born on January 29, 1965. He is known to Russian viewers for the TV series "Kept Women", "Ranevskaya", "Sklifosovsky", "Capercaillie", "Wolf Messing: Who Saw through Time" and many others. In total, Maxim Glotov took part in more than 120 television and film projects during his career.
